Who is Magnar Freimuth?
Magnar Freimuth was an Estonian nordic combined skier who competed in the early 1990s. He finished fourth in the 3 x 10 km team event at the 1994 Winter Olympics in Lillehammer.
Freimuth's best individual finish was 14th in a 15 km individual event in Norway in 1994.
